The Source of Information

MA real estate listings are normally compiled in a database, known as the Multiple Listing Service (MLS), by local real estate agents. The data is then shared to other companies through data feeds. These other companies reformat the data and show them differently on their websites.

Even though all of the sites extract information from MLS, they do not actually pull everything or every available field from MLS. Listing companies can also opt-out of getting their listings included in the feed. Additionally, these websites might only check for new listings at specific intervals, so new inventory might not instantly display. If you are looking for home listings in a quickly moving real estate market, a delay in viewing a brand new home for sale may result in missing your dream home.

Tips On Finding Real Estate Listings In MA

Going on the Internet is a good way to perform a property search, but keep in mind that licensed real estate agents have access to all listings and full listing information including disclosures. Real estate agents will either evaluate homes for sale for you or give you direct access to MLS through their MLS access. Ask your real estate agents for more details.
